相关推荐
-
asp.net源程序编译为dll文件并调用的实现过程
很多时候,我们需要将.cs文件单独编译成.dll文件,这就需要使用csc命令将.cs文件编译成.dll动态链接库文件。具体的操作步骤如下: 打开命令窗口->输入cmd到控制台->cd C:WINDOWSMicrosoft.NETFrameworkv1.1.4322 转到vs.net安装的该目录下->执行csc命令csc /target:library File.cs->在该目录下产生一个对应名字的.dll文件(前提:把.cs文件放到C:WINDOWSMicrosoft.NETFrameworkv1.1.4322目录下) csc命令的方式很多,请参考以下 编译 File.cs 以产生 Fil
-
如何编写Windows CE.net的usb驱动程序(2)(转)
上述讲了堆理论,可能读者脑袋都已经大了,为此,我们举个简单的例子来详细说明一下驱动程序的开发过程。 例如我们有个USB Mouse设备,设备信息描述如下: Device Descriptor: bcdUSB: 0x0100 bD...
-
在EXE中创建、加载内核驱动
其实这个想法来自一个程序。当时想试验一下arp攻击,还以为win32下有相关的系统调用,google了一把,不,baidu了一把,google看 不懂,说win32下发包IpPacket到可以,Arp只能用IpHlpApi提供的SendARP()函数发送(可能孤陋寡闻),而且不能手动构造 arp包,而且SP2下发送TCP SYN是不允许的。晕。借助工具的话就要使用WinPcap,或者自己写驱动。
-
.NET REST API的数据驱动本地化
由于云的高度自动化,软件模型和数据变得越来越动态。让我们以一家在线水果店为例,该商店在多个国家/地区销售其产品。新产品由用户以不同的语言输入。
-
用C#开发网络防火墙技术分析
N-Byte网络守望者是一款单机版网络安全工具,简言之,就是一个用.NET开发的个人版防火墙。在N-Byte网络守望者1.0版的开发中,使用了NDIS Hook Driver技术来实现网络封包过滤功能,这使N-Byte网络守望者能够在网络层过滤网络封包,从而实现强大的功能。 由于软件的主程序是用C#写的,C#中没有提供具有类似DeviceIoControl函数功能的驱动设备控制函数,而NDIS
-
NDIS HOOK的几种方法
NDIS HOOK大概有三种方法 1,Inline HOOK NDIS 的分发函数 2,修改 ndis.sys的导出表 3,注册一个假协议驱动,并通过协议链表找到tcpip节点,修改它的分发函数
-
NDIS HOOK开发简单日志
今天调试了下uay backdoor, 其实基于ndis hook的想法的rootkit,2003年的时候我已经想过,一直没有动手了,看来实战第一. 呵呵,当然波兰的女hacker的rootkit 似乎也是这个思路,没有公布一点源码,这里我们应该感谢uay; 他在源代码里面也提到是采用了gjp的ndis hook技术---fake protocol,其实就是注册一个假协议获取协议连,从而递归来ho
-
.NET领域驱动开发(DDD)框架搭建
http:// 详细内容讲解:https://study.163.com/course/introduction/1005643030.htm?share=1&shareId=1142344671内容:一步一步搭建一个实用的基于领域驱动设计(DDD)开发模式的一个项目开发框架。通过结合实际的代码应用让大家对领域驱动开发有一个更好的理解。源码:https://github.com/lidin...
-
Visual C++.NET 开发驱动程序详解
Visual C++.NET 开发驱动程序详解
-
探索NDIS HOOK新的实现方法
NDIS HOOK是专业级防火墙使用的一种拦截技术,NDIS HOOK的重点是如何获得特定协议对NDIS_PROTOCOL_BLOCK指针,获得了该指针,接 下来就可以替换该协议所注册的收发函数,而达到拦截网络数据的目的。
-
远程桌面 服务端全驱动(通信用NDIS HOOK,屏幕直接读显存)
监控端代码采用 汇编 + Winscok 源代码如下: local nNetTimeout,wsa:WSADATA,hScrDC,hMemDC,hBitmap,ScrnBufPoint PaketLen equ 1000 .data bi dd 28h,0,0,200 dup (0) Buffer
-
driver驱动开发
驱动开发注意事项 不能访问C库 只有一个很小的定长堆栈 没有内存保护机制 浮点数很难使用,应该使用整型数 Kconfig 描述了所属目录源文档相关的内核配置菜单,用于make menuconfig中的配置 示例: menu "Network device support" config NETDEVICES bool "Enable Net Devices" 菜单类型 depends on NET 该项依赖项,如果没有选中NET,则不会显示这项菜单。
-
书写NDIS过滤钩子驱动实现ip包过滤
转载请注明原作者安全焦点在普通的WINDOWS 2000下实现实现包过滤的方法主要是书写NDIS过滤驱动程序,需要的技巧比较高,而且烦琐,需要考虑很多细节。但是对于很多应用而言,只需要能更方便的对ip包进行过滤处理,其实NDIS对于ip包的过滤提供一种书写过滤钩子驱动的方式,主要方法是:驱动中建立一个普通的设备,然后通过IOCTL_PF_SET_EXTENSION_POINTER操作将你的内核模式
-
.NET领域驱动设计—实践(穿过迷雾走向光明)
阅读目录 开篇介绍 1.1示例介绍 (OnlineExamination在线考试系统介绍) 1.2分析、建模 (对真实业务进行分析、模型化) 1.2.1 用例分析 (提取系统的所有功能需求) 1.3系统设计、建模 (技术化业务模型) 1.3.1 枚举类型的使用 (别让枚举类型成为数值型对象) 1.3.2 基础数据、业务数据 (显示实体和隐式过程) 1....
-
.NET 中自定义事件的驱动(C#)
.NET 中自定义事件的驱动(C#)(Wonsoft) 在Windows应用的开发过程中,常常会借助Windows的事件驱动机制,自己定义事件,使应用程序的具有更好的封装。特别是在基于组件的应用开发中,更能体现其优越性。当然在MFC中自定义事件是很容易的一件事,但在C#中有其特有的定义模式。 首先定义事件是很容易的一件事,但光定义了事件,而不驱动这个事件,那么事件的定义就毫
19 楼 yhjhoo 2011-07-14 10:44
18 楼 mayer_mq 2011-06-13 14:08
chrome也有插件
17 楼 hlbng 2011-06-13 09:14
16 楼 LargeBean 2011-06-13 09:14
15 楼 vsover 2011-06-12 22:40
14 楼 lance4t 2011-06-12 21:37
方滨兴这厮就不能监控国民了
HTTPS是洪水猛兽,君不见只要HTTPS域名基本都杀了
看不见内容就杀,宁可错杀一亿,不可放过一个
13 楼 freish 2011-06-12 08:46
方滨兴这厮就不能监控国民了
12 楼 jtyb 2011-06-11 22:19
11 楼 rubynroll 2011-06-11 15:25
10 楼 javaeyebird 2011-06-11 15:10
需要 xpi格式的插件
9 楼 aninfeel 2011-06-11 10:18
8 楼 yy77 2011-06-10 16:04
7 楼 devworks 2011-06-10 15:47
6 楼 Joo 2011-06-10 15:44
5 楼 redstarofsleep 2011-06-10 14:47
4 楼 xyang81 2011-06-10 14:37
3 楼 haha1903 2011-06-10 14:36
其实其它在线支付早就应该解决在非IE浏览器上使用的问题!居然被后来者暂了先机,现在使用苹果和Linux操作系统的人也可以进行网上支付了,顶下!
新闻说可以使用 firefox,但好像没说在 os x 下是不是可以用。
2 楼 lamjiarong 2011-06-10 11:59
1 楼 zxhcloth 2011-06-10 11:38
其实其它在线支付早就应该解决在非IE浏览器上使用的问题!居然被后来者暂了先机,现在使用苹果和Linux操作系统的人也可以进行网上支付了,顶下!